Love Letters Stamp & Die Bundle
Let’s start with Love Letters Stamp & Die Bundle. When pressed for time, you can create something quick with these easy ideas. To make these cards I focused on negative and positive die cutting. Every time we create a die cut we have a positive piece (the die cut we created) and a negative (something we usually throw away). This technique allows you to use your dies in a whole new way. I want to show you different ways you can use negative and positive die cutting.
This is the perfect bundle for creating Clean&Simple cards. My first card is a long card featuring repeated negative die cutting technique using Love Letters Die Set.
I watercolored a slim background panel with Altenew metallic ink sprays in following colors: Lagoon and Orange Cream. I then used the dies to create a unique negative die cut piece. I glued my panel onto a white card base, stamped a sentiment and finished off the card with some sequins.
The next card I made with the same way but to make it more interesting I created a shaker card.
This time to color my panel I used the following colors for a color combo: Puffy Heart and Orange Cream. I die cut the hearts in the colored panel (I kept some positive die cuts and glued it on the panel ), adhered a layer of clear acetate from the back of the negative panel, outlined the opening with thick foam squares, added sequins, closed that shut with another layer of acetate and adhered my shaker element onto a white card base.

Flower Vine Stamp & Die Bundle
I’ve become quite a fan of dark backgrounds and “long” cards! I know that most people are afraid of them. Now seems like dark backgrounds are becoming trendy. This trend came mostly with pencil coloring and heat embossing technique. Using black for a card base can add a lot of contrast to the otherwise simple card. I used Flower Vine Stamp & Die Bundle to make these cards.
The first card is my favorite. It looks simple but elegant!
I made a panel out of black cardstock and heat embossed the flowers in the middle of the panel using the Antique Gold Embossing Powder. I then stamped a sentiment in black ink onto a white cardstock stripe. I used thin foam adhesive and foam mounted the sentiment stripe onto the background and added some clear drops.
For the next card I did very simple coloring.
I started by stamping the flowers onto black cardstock using clear inks and gold heat embossed.
After I was done, I used the coordinating dies with the Mini Blossom Die Cutting Machine to die cut the images. I foam mounted flowers and leaves on my black card panel and cut out the excess.
I popped up a sentiment, gold heat embossed on black cardstock. At last, I glued my panel onto a white card base and finished off the card with July Crystals.
The next card is a long card. I love non traditional card sizes recently.
I heat embossed a floral background in white pearl embossing powder on white cardstock. Next, I stamped, colored in and die-cut images out of the cardstock and arranged them onto my panel.
I colored the images with copic markers: R20, R22, V12, V15, V17, BG13, BG49. I stamped the sentiment and added s some clear drops.
Bed of Roses Stamp Set
My next card is a simple one-layer card featuring the basic technique – Stamping. The Bed of Roses stamp set is a perfect for this technique.
I stamped the images using the set of Altenew inks, stamped a sentiment and added some sequins.
Engagement Wishes Stamp & Die Bundle
I love playing with new sizes. It’s different, I have more room, so I made a long, dimensional card. Flowers from the new Engagement Wishes Stamp set are just gorgeous and I love how it turned out. The size of the card is 8 1/2 x 4 1/2 inches.
I started working on the card by gold heat embossing the beautiful rose and leaves from the stamp set in Altenew Antique Gold Embossing Powder onto a white card stock. Next, I watercolored the images with ZIG “Art and Graphic Twin” markers.
I used the coordinating dies with the Mini Blossom Die Cutting Machine to die cut the images.
I then gold heat embossed the images onto a card panel and made blending various colors of Altenew inks: mountain mist and pink diamond. I arranged all flowers and leaves on a long folded card base.
The sentiment is from the same set was stamped on white cardstock. I finished it off with some sequins.
Mega Greetings 3 Stamp & Die Bundle + Love Letters Die
Do you like to get your fingers inky with inks? 🙂 My next card is a card with bokeh background. This technique requires only inks and masks.
I started with masking off lower part of a piece of white card stock and creating a bokeh effect with Altenew inks and Love letters Die. I then stamped sentiment using black ink and heat embossed it with clear embossing powder. I added some sequins.
Wispy Begonia Stamp Set
I decided to do some pencil coloring for a a simple floral card featuring Wispy Begonia Stamp Set. I went with this image because of its size and the amount of white or open space. Whenever I do pencil coloring I make sure that the image I pick for my coloring is large enough so that I can actually do some color blending.
I heat embossed the flowers and leaves in white pearl embossing powder on gray cardstock and colored each with colored pencils. Coloring process went rather quickly and I can’t say it took me longer than 30-40 minutes.
I popped up a sentiment. At last, I glued my panel onto a white card base and finished off the card with Midnight Blue Crystals.
